Milan, Fassone: “Champions League our minimum goal. Otherwise…”

Milan’s CEO spoke about the strategies of the club

MILAN FASSONE CHAMPIONS / Milan's CEO Fassone was interviewed by “The Guardian'. he spoke about the current strategies of the club.

“We probably are the most International club in Italy. Although Juventus won more Italian title, the European competitions are in our DNA. We are happy to play in the Europa League but our natural environment is the Champions League. Our owners want to play that competition soon. It is important for the finances of the club. This is our minimum goal.

We have a plan A and B. We have presented UEFA with a plan that doesn't include the qualification to the Champions League. In this case, our investments will be reduced and we would be forced to sell one of our best players.

Let's talk about the worst case. In October, Milan's owner will be Elliott. We will go ahead with Mr. Li but if something happens Elliott will keep the team. We are talking about one of the most important investment funds in the world. They would have the club for €300 million, a very low amount. Then, they will be able to do business with it. This is what they are expert in.”
